Personal driver

We are looking for an experienced personal/ family driver for clients located in Monaco and South of France. The personal driver will accompany the clients on every travel so he will have specific tasks and responsibilities that he must fully manage.

Responsibilities

Security

  • Providing a professional and courteous transportation service
  • Ensuring safe driving
  • Complying with traffic regulations
  • Ensuring the safety of all: passengers, other motorists, pedestrians, and cyclists

Services

  • Greeting clients professionally and warmly
  • Assisting clients with loading and unloading of their belongings as needed
  • Unless otherwise instructed, choosing the fastest routes based on GPS software and traffic updates
  • If requested, complete collections and deliveries on behalf of the client
  • Keeping the vehicle in a good condition and excellent working order
  • Forecasting and responding to customer concerns and questions
  • Keeping track of the insurances of the cars and all administrative regulatory documents

Communication

  • Liaison with the company or client to determine when and where the individual will be collected
  • Being able to respond and communicate perfectly with clients to meet their needs

General organization

  • Chauffeurs must keep track of their employer's schedule and travel plans, which necessitates strong organizational skills
  • They must also keep track of their employer's belongings and make certain that they have everything they need for the day
  • Chauffeurs are frequently required to keep track of their employer's vehicle and ensure that it is clean and ready for use

Required skills

Driving skills

  • Drivers must have a driving license for a minimum of 10 years
  • Drivers must be able to drive in a variety of conditions, such as heavy traffic, highways, and inclement weather
  • Drivers should also be able to parallel park and maneuver in congested areas

Communication skills

  • Drivers must be fluent in English (Russian and French are optional)
  • Must be able to communicate effectively in person, on the phone, and via written correspondence

Mechanical skills

  • Drivers should be able to perform basic mechanical maintenance on the vehicles: checking tire pressure, changing a flat tire, and checking the oil etc
